I downloaded Update 5.04 and tried to install it, but it keeps insisting that I don't have ACT! 2000 (version 5.0.x) installed on my computer. I actually have ACT! 2000, build 5.0.3.423, on my computer. How do I get around this and get the update to recognize the version I have?

My guess is that you are using Norton antivirus or system works. If so the fix is to uninstall both ACT! 6 and Norton, restart the computer and then reinstall ACT! first and open ACT! 6 at least once and then reinstall Norton. Norton now blocks registry keys critical to the full installation of ACT! 6. If ACT! 6 is install first, everything should work.
